Migrating to Windows Phone (Paperback)
暫譯: 遷移至 Windows Phone (平裝本)

Jesse Liberty, Jeff Blankenburg

  • 出版商: Apress
  • 出版日期: 2011-12-22
  • 售價: $1,720
  • 貴賓價: 9.5$1,634
  • 語言: 英文
  • 頁數: 264
  • 裝訂: Paperback
  • ISBN: 143023816X
  • ISBN-13: 9781430238164
  • 已絕版

買這商品的人也買了...

相關主題

商品描述

This book offers everything you'll need to upgrade your existing programming knowledge and begin to develop applications for the Windows Phone.

It focuses on the 75 percent of the material that you will need 95 percent of the time. We're not going to teach you object-oriented programming (OOP) all over again, but we are going to take the time to point out how .NET and C# differ in their execution of the standard OOP concepts from other languages' implementations in order to make your migration as smooth and stress-free as possible.

Migrating to Windows Phone will lead you through a tour of the key features of developing for Microsoft's devices. We'll consider everything from data handling to accelerometers, from mapping to WCF. We'll also walk you through monetizing your application through Microsoft's online Windows Phone store.

What you’ll learn

  • To get your phone, IDE and other tools set up in an efficient manner
  • The controls that are available to you in Windows Phone programming and how they can be applied
  • To apply concepts of a non-trivial demo application to your own application context
  • To point out the key elements of both the phone and the Visual Studio IDE
  • The principles of push and pull data and data-binding
  • To work with the features that make the Windows Phone unique (Bing Maps, WCF, Silverlight)
  • To monetize your applications through advertising, the Windows Phone Marketplace, and other channels

Who this book is for

This book is for anyone seeking to develop applications for the Windows Phone. No prior Silverlight or C# knowledge is required, although an understanding of programming in general, and object-oriented programming in particular, is assumed. Notes are used liberally to highlight features and concepts that might be confusing to programmers unfamiliar with .NET and C#.

Table of Contents

  1. Get Set Up: Getting all the tools
  2. Get to Work: Building a non-trivial application
  3. Get Control: Exploring the Windows Phone 7 controls
  4. Get the Data: Working with data-bound applications
  5. Get a Life: The Windows Phone 7 life cycle
  6. Get Moving: Enhancing your applications with Animation
  7. Get a Job: Interacting with the Phone, camera, GPS, etc.
  8. Get Pushy: Push notifications
  9. Get Online: Connecting to and browsing the web
  10. Get Lost: GPS, location services and maps
  11. Get Money: The Marketplace and monetizing your application

商品描述(中文翻譯)

這本書提供了您所需的一切,以升級您現有的程式設計知識並開始為 Windows Phone 開發應用程式。

本書專注於您在 95% 的時間內需要的 75% 內容。我們不會重新教您物件導向程式設計(OOP),但我們會花時間指出 .NET 和 C# 在執行標準 OOP 概念方面與其他語言實現的不同,以使您的遷移過程盡可能順利且無壓力。

《遷移到 Windows Phone》將引導您了解為微軟設備開發的關鍵特性。我們將考慮從數據處理到加速度計,從地圖到 WCF 的所有內容。我們還將指導您如何通過微軟的在線 Windows Phone 商店來獲利您的應用程式。

您將學到的內容:
- 以高效的方式設置您的手機、IDE 和其他工具
- 在 Windows Phone 程式設計中可用的控制項及其應用方式
- 將非簡單示範應用程式的概念應用到您自己的應用程式上下文中
- 指出手機和 Visual Studio IDE 的關鍵元素
- 推送和拉取數據及數據綁定的原則
- 使用使 Windows Phone 獨特的功能(Bing 地圖、WCF、Silverlight)
- 通過廣告、Windows Phone Marketplace 和其他渠道來獲利您的應用程式

本書適合對象:
這本書適合任何希望為 Windows Phone 開發應用程式的人。雖然不需要先前的 Silverlight 或 C# 知識,但假設您對程式設計有一般的理解,特別是物件導向程式設計。書中會大量使用註解來突出可能對不熟悉 .NET 和 C# 的程式設計師造成困惑的特性和概念。

目錄:
1. 設置:獲取所有工具
2. 開始工作:構建一個非簡單的應用程式
3. 獲取控制:探索 Windows Phone 7 控制項
4. 獲取數據:處理數據綁定應用程式
5. 獲取生命:Windows Phone 7 的生命週期
6. 獲取動態:用動畫增強您的應用程式
7. 獲取工作:與手機、相機、GPS 等互動
8. 獲取推送:推送通知
9. 獲取在線:連接和瀏覽網頁
10. 獲取定位:GPS、位置服務和地圖
11. 獲取收益:Marketplace 和獲利您的應用程式